- The distance between Hami, China and Brisbane, Queensland, Australia is approximately 9,901 km or 6,152 mi.
- To reach Hami in this distance one would set out from Brisbane, Queensland bearing 320.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hami bearing 310° or NW .
- Hami has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Brisbane, Queensland has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The average annual temperature is 10.7 °C (19.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27 °C (48.6°F) more in Hami.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1190.2 mm (46.9 in) less which is equivalent to 1190.2 l/m² (29.21 US gal/ft²) or 11,902,000 l/ha (1,272,403 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14.6° lower in Hami than in Brisbane, Queensland.
